The Wedding Singer is about to take you on a hilarious musical adventure. It is based on the box office smashing Hollywood hit of the same name, which starred renowned comedic actor Adam Sandler and the beautiful Drew Barrymore. The movie’s success led the Broadway producers to come up with The Wedding Singer musical, which premiered in Seattle in February 2006.

The movie grossed a massive $123.3 million at the box office. On this end, Chad Beguelin and Matthew Skylar’s musical adaptation received eight Drama Desk Award and five Tony Award nominations including Best Original Score and Best Musical. Two UK tours later (2007 and 2017), the musical is here at the Troubadour Wembley Park Theatre, and you are just a ticket away! It is available for a limited run and stars Kevin Clifton for the iconic role of Robbie Hart.

An arrangement of great songs

The musical comprises an excellent list of songs such as “Grow Old With You” which has music and lyrics by Tim Herlihy and Adam Sandler himself, along with other tracks like “Move That Thang”, “It’s Your Wedding Day”, “All About the Green”, and “Today You Are A Man”.

This production features Matthew Skylar’s music and Chad Beguelin’s lyrics. These songs make the musical wonderful and a show that stands up to the name of the original movie. If you loved the film, it is time to relive your memories.

The Wedding Singer musical will take you to the era of nostalgia

The year is 1985, and wannabe rockstar Robbie Hart is living in his grandmother’s basement. He is the heart of the party and the most-desired wedding singer in New Jersey. But, this only lasts until Linda, his fiance, abandons him at the altar. With a shattered heart, a devastated Robbie turns every wedding into a disaster-piece like his own.

He happens to meet an admiring young waitress named Julia and falls in deep love with her. As is his luck, a Wall Street shark is set to marry her. Unless Robbie manages to put on a terrific performance, he will lose his love forever.

The Wedding Singer musical, with its list of pop songs, will submerge you in the ambience of the 80s when style was different and a wedding singer was literally a celebrity.
